Amman
City Tour – Jerash – Dead Sea – Amman overnight |
| |
::
After breakfast we enjoy a city tour in Amman, the friendly, modern
and safe capital of Jordan. The town is already mentioned in the
Old Testament as Rabbath Ammon and in Greco-Roman times as Philadelphia.
You visit the Amphitheater and the Jordan Folklore Museum, the
Citadel and the King Abdullah Mosque.
:: After
we drive in the north of Jordan to Jerash, the best example of
a roman provincial city in the whole Middle East. We visit the
spectacular forum, roman colonnaded street, nymphaeum, Artemis
temple, St. Cosmos and Demeanors church.
:: The
Dead Sea is our next destination. The Dead Sea is the lowest point
on earth (417 m below sea level) and the largest "Natural
Spa" in the world. The mineral-rich waters and mud flow with
natural health and beauty benefits acclaimed globally. You have
the opportunity to float in the Dead Sea and experience the feeling
not to sink in water.

Amman
– Desert Castles (Amra-Kharanah-Azraq-Halabat) – Amman
overnight |
| |
::
Today starts our tour to the Desert Castles in eastern Jordan.
The Amra Castle adornes with its zodiac dome and the early examples
of Omayyad fresco paintings, and there are still the fortress-like
mysterious Qasr Kha-ranah, the black basalt Roman/Medieval Islamic
fort at Azraq and the Omayyad residential palace of Qasr Al-Hallabat.
After our lunch break in Azraq we drive back to hotel for overnight.

Amman
– Mt. Nebo – Madaba – King’s Highway –
Kerak – Petra overnight
|
| |
::
After breakfast we depart for Mt. Nebo. This is the place
where Moses gazed at the promised land before he died. You visit
the old monastery and overlook the Jordan valley, Dead Sea, Jericho
and Jerusalem.
:: After
we proceed to Madaba, where the famous mosaic 6th century map
of Palestine in St. George’s church is sited.
:: Following
this, we drive to Kerak along the famous ancient biblical caravan
route the king's way. We have a short stop in Wadi Al-Mujib, a
great wide valley, which sweeps your breath away for it's magnificent
geological formation. Kerak, the ancient, biblical capital of
the Moabites, become well known for the famous crusaders castle
that was built in 1132/34 by king Baldwin the first of Jerusalem.
Visit the castle, enjoy the amazing undergrounds halls and the
museum.

Petra full day tour
and overnight |
| |
::
After breakfast departure for a full day tour to the red rose
city Petra, the biggest attraction of Jordan. Petra was first
established around the 6th century B.C. by the Nabataean Arabs,
a nomadic tribe who settled in the area and laid the foundations
of a commercial empire that extended into Syria. After the conquest
by the Romans 106 AD Petra declined in importance thereafter.
In the early 19th century the Swiss explorer Johann L. Burckhardt
discovered the city again.
:: Upon
arrival you will begin an unforgettable trip on horse back to
the canyon, the so called Siq, and then by foot to the most beautiful
monument: the Treasury. The local guide will give a brief history
of the city. Among other monuments you will see are Pharaoh's
Castle, the Triumphal Arch, the Amphitheater and the Monastery
„El Deir“.
